Membrane technology offers various benefits to remove contaminants from the water according to the pore size and the physical properties without any by-products. In particular, nanofiltration is a promising technique to eliminate hazardous micro-pollutants such as pharmaceutically active compounds (PhAC) and endocrine disrupting compounds (EDCs). However, we found that removal efficiency of targeted micro-pollutants was depending on the conditions of total dissolved solid (TDS) of feed water. In order to identify main reason of these results, we used an analytical method to evaluate the proportion of natural organic matters (NOM), which could play an important role in membrane fouling, thus may declining the performance of membrane process. In this study, the objective is to demonstrate organic species responsible for fouling in membrane process depending on concentration of TDS. |
